Hi,

I am moving to Santa Fe this Summer in hopes of being busy in my profession. I'm in my 40's and a massage therapist. I am wondering if the spas are really slow in the Winter time or if in season I will do well enough to compensate.

Also I have been hearing a lot about the crime being high, are there any areas to avoid?

Any responses are appreciated.

I don't live in SF but visit often (live in Abq). I would imagine that being a massage therapist that winter time would be good. With all the skiers in town they would probably like a good massage after a day of skiing.
